Will olive oil help my dog's arthritis?
Yes, extra virgin olive oil can help manage a dog's arthritis due to its anti-inflammatory properties. Rich in antioxidants like oleocanthal, it helps reduce joint pain, improve mobility, and lubricate joints. It is safe to add in moderation, typically 1 teaspoon per 20 lbs of body weight daily.
Fish oil decreases the production of potent lipids that cause inflammation in the joints. Studies show that when fish oil is given to arthritic dogs and cats, these animals tend to be more comfortable and agile than those not supplemented.
Does olive oil help joint pain in dogs?
Many dogs develop arthritis as they age. As an anti-inflammatory, regular doses of olive oil in a dog's diet can help reduce the amount of pain and stiffness that an aging dog feels. Is Olive Oil Bad for Dogs? 3 Risks- Weight Gain/Obesity. Olive oil is high in calories. ...
- Pancreatitis. Because olive oil is a fat, excessive intake can trigger pancreatitis in dogs. ...
- Gastrointestinal Upset. Although a small amount of olive oil can help alleviate constipation, too much can cause diarrhea or vomiting.
